- Start with a 4-1/4" x 11" half sheet of card stock. Darla used Real Red card stock.
- Fold it in half like a vertical card. That fold will become the side of the cup that is opposite the handle.
- Line up the 5-1/2" wide card stock horizontally so the fold is on the non-tab side of the die (as shown above), but the fold is NOT under the cutting blade. The die-cut tabs on the opposite side will become the handle.
- Line up the 4-1/4" side so that the bottom is under the cutting blade, but the top is not under the cutting blade. The photo of the assembled project with the die should help you get a visual of how it's situated in the die for cutting.
- Emboss the mug with the Softly Falling Texture Impressions Folder. You'll have to run it through twice, embossing one side of the cup and then the other.
- Adhere the tabs together back-to-back to form the handle.
- Carefully punch out the handle hole with the Word Window Punch.
- Decorate!
Complete Supplies List—"Clear mount" is a rubber stamp to be used on a clear acrylic block, "Photopolymer" is the see-thru style of stamps, also used with acrylic blocks.
- Stamps—Among The Branches (photopolymer)
- Ink—Mossy Meadow Classic Ink Pads
- Paper—Home For Christmas DSP; Silver Glimmer Paper; Real Red & Whisper White card stock
- Accessories—Tea Lace Doilies, Silver Metallic Thread
- Tools—Square Pillow Box Die, Circles Collection Framelits, Softly Falling Texture Impressions Folder, Big Shot, 2" Circle Punch, Word Window Punch, Tear & Tape Adhesive, SNAIL, Dimensionals
